Isn't it amusing and sad watching our pathetic government now try to actually do something about the tariff threat?

Example.

Liquor sales. Ford wants LCBO to remove all American liquor from the shelves if the tariffs go through. LCBO is one of the biggest buyers of alcohol in the world. Obviously that would devastate many American producers.

My question is, why have we prioritized for so many years American producers, and not let Canadian companies compete more? Specifically why has our government worked for so many years to restrict inter provincial trade on alcohol sales? Up till 2019 it was a CRIME to transport beer across provincial lines. Many provinces still don't allow direct to consumer sales across Canada, etc, etc.
